Bitcoin ATMs vs. Exchanges: What’s the Difference?
Share

As cryptocurrency becomes increasingly prominent in today's financial world, it is essential to understand the different avenues available for conducting Bitcoin transactions. This guide will succinctly illustrate the key distinctions between Bitcoin ATMs and Exchanges, facilitating your navigation through the intricate landscape of cryptocurrency with the accuracy of a blockchain transaction.

Bitcoin Exchanges - The Digital Marketplace

Bitcoin Exchanges serve as the virtual counterparts of traditional stock exchanges within the realm of cryptocurrency. These online platforms enable users to trade Bitcoin just as they would with traditional currencies or stocks. One notable advantage of exchanges is the ability to convert Bitcoin into a plethora of altcoins, including Ethereum, Litecoin, and more.

However, as with any platform, Bitcoin Exchanges come with their share of drawbacks. Potential latency in withdrawal times can pose a significant issue, and the fact that the Bitcoin is often stored in-house implies an inherent risk, as you are not in direct control of your coins. I mean, it is hard to forget the collapse of FTX in 2023.

Remember, not your keys, not your coins.

Moreover, Canadian Bitcoin Exchanges are registered as Money Service Businesses (MSBs), requiring ID verification in accordance with FINTRAC regulations.

Bitcoin ATMs - The Physical Portals to Crypto

On the other side of the coin, so to speak, are Bitcoin ATMs. These devices emulate traditional ATMs, but for cryptocurrency, providing a quick and straightforward way for users to convert Canadian dollars into Bitcoin.

Bitcoin ATMs do require you to physically transact at its location, however, it ensures quick and easy settlement. Weighing Your Options

Choosing the right Bitcoin transaction method boils down to a careful analysis of your individual needs. If you're looking for a wider cryptocurrency portfolio and don't mind navigating complex trading environments, an exchange might be your ideal path. On the other hand, if you desire a simple, direct transaction mechanism, a Bitcoin ATM could be the preferred choice.
